Just like in Savannah, you have to establish strong boundaries.
You have a voice, or a roar, so use it. Think of yourself as a lion, roaring loudly, letting your friends know what you want. It’ll feel like a major weight is taken off your chest. If your friends keep it up, it’s good to be assertive even if your friends don’t like it. Protect your territory and show your friends where you stand.
The friends who don’t respect boundaries aren’t the kind you should not associate with. It might be hard, but sometimes ending the friendship is the best thing you can do. Surrounding yourself with peeps who respect and love you is so important. Surrounding yourself with positivity can get rid of the possibility of peer pressure.
Being true to yourself is soooooo important, like a lion is true to their pride! Be strong, and don’t let anyone push you around!
